Discussion Overview
The discussion centers on the importance of high school Physics and Chemistry (referred to as Physical Science in South Africa) in relation to pursuing Physics and Mathematics at the university level. Participants explore the relevance of these subjects compared to Mathematics and share personal experiences regarding their performance and understanding in these areas.

Main Points Raised
- One participant questions the necessity of focusing on Physics and Chemistry if they perform well in Mathematics, expressing concern over exam performance and stress.
- Another participant notes that in the USA, college science courses are taught from scratch, implying that prior knowledge of Physics and Chemistry may not be essential.
- A different viewpoint emphasizes that introductory high school Physics and Chemistry are important for developing intuition about physical sciences, despite not imparting deep knowledge.
- One participant argues that many students approach Physics from a mathematical perspective, potentially missing the physical concepts that underlie the mathematics.
- Another participant mentions that lab components in university courses may provide practical experience that complements theoretical knowledge.
- Some participants share personal experiences of transitioning to college with varying levels of high school preparation, suggesting that success is achievable regardless of high school performance.
- Advice is offered on improving exam techniques and reducing stress, emphasizing the importance of understanding material and practicing problem-solving skills.
- One participant reflects on their tendency to make mistakes during exams due to subconscious stress, indicating a need for better exam strategies.
Areas of Agreement / Disagreement
Participants express differing views on the importance of high school Physics and Chemistry, with some arguing for their significance in developing a foundational understanding, while others suggest that university courses can compensate for any gaps in knowledge. The discussion remains unresolved regarding the necessity of focusing on these subjects versus Mathematics.
